Indeed, REM is essential for the brain. I think that this could be one of the more harmful effects of marijuana imo
https://www.nichd.nih.gov/health/topics/sleep/conditioninfo/Pages/rem-sleep.aspx
REM sleep stimulates regions of the brain that are used for learning. Studies have shown that when people are deprived of REM sleep, they are not able to remember what they were taught before going to sleep.3 Lack of REM sleep has also been linked to certain health conditions, including migraines.2
The reason for dreaming during REM sleep is not understood. While some of the signals sent to the cortex during sleep are important for learning and memory, some signals seem to be random. It is these random signals that may form the basis for a "story" that the brain's cortex tries to interpret or find meaning in, resulting in dreaming.3

While it is true that many Japanese eat a lot of fish, this can't be said for all Japanese. Even though I traveled there a few times, I am certainly not an expert on this subject.
The population of Japan that is often the subject of all longevity studies eats very little fish or meat. I am talking about Okinawa Islands (Japan) people. There subject to several studies and famous Blue Zone Happiness book. I read the book but I am not promoting it here and there other sources for this information on the web. Nevertheless, Okinawa people are one of the blue zones.
